Vista Service Pack 1

Hi

Wonder if you can help. My laptop (over a year old) is trying to install Vista SP 1 (KB936330). It states that it is published 9 September.

Trouble is, I thought my laptop updated itself back in March.

Not had to do any reinstalls or anything of the like. Any ideas why it is trying to do it again?

Thanks

Comments

  • hi

    try the following to see if its already installed (dependant on the setup of your start menu)

    start > type WINVER in the search or run box then click ok or press enter.

    a small window will open telling you what operatin system you have .. it will also list the build and service pack if its installed ..

    if it is there then i might just be an addition update .. microsft has been putting a few vista updated out over the past wee while
